The Art Of Etching Metals: A Detailed Guide
Etching metals is a fascinating process that has been used for centuries to create intricate designs on various types of metals This technique involves using acids or other chemicals to cut into the surface of the metal, creating detailed patterns or images Etching can be used for decorative purposes, such as creating jewelry or decorative objects, as well as for practical applications like creating circuit boards or metal components for machinery.

One of the most common methods of etching metals is known as chemical etching This technique involves applying a resist material, such as wax or a special type of ink, to the surface of the metal The resist material protects the areas of the metal that you want to remain untouched, while the exposed areas are etched away by an acid or other chemical solution.
To begin the chemical etching process, you will need to first prepare your metal surface by cleaning it thoroughly and ensuring that it is free of any oils or contaminants Once the metal is clean, you can apply your resist material using a brush, stencil, or other application method Be sure to apply the resist material evenly and allow it to dry completely before moving on to the etching step.
Next, you will need to prepare your etching solution There are several different types of acids and chemicals that can be used for etching metals, including ferric chloride, nitric acid, and hydrochloric acid It is important to choose the right etchant for the type of metal you are working with, as different metals will react differently to each type of chemical.
Once your etching solution is prepared, you can begin the etching process by immersing your metal into the solution Depending on the type of metal and the strength of the etchant, the etching process can take anywhere from a few minutes to several hours It is important to monitor the progress of the etching closely to ensure that the desired depth and detail are achieved.

This can be done using a variety of methods, such as scraping, sanding, or using a solvent to dissolve the resist material Once the resist is removed, you can clean and polish the metal to bring out the full beauty of the etched design.
In addition to chemical etching, there are also other methods of etching metals that do not involve the use of acids or chemicals One such method is known as electrochemical etching, which uses an electric current to etch the metal surface This technique is often used for creating precise designs on metal parts, such as serial numbers or logos.
To perform electrochemical etching, you will need a special tool called an etching machine, which is equipped with a power supply, electrode, and etching solution The metal part to be etched is connected to the negative terminal of the power supply, while the electrode is connected to the positive terminal When the power is turned on, the electric current flows through the etching solution, causing the metal to be etched away in a controlled manner.
Another method of etching metals is known as laser etching, which uses a high-powered laser to remove material from the metal surface This technique is commonly used in industrial applications, such as marking metal parts with serial numbers or barcodes Laser etching is a precise and efficient method of etching metals, but it can be expensive and requires specialized equipment.
